Orthodontics
Orthodontists at the University of Louisville School of Dentistry diagnose, prevent and treat dental and facial irregularities. Residents treat a wide variety of malocclusions (improperly aligned teeth and/or jaws). Young children, teens and adults are regularly treated. All modern techniques are practiced and the one best suited for your treatment will be recommended.
Esthetic braces and invisalign for adults and children are available. As a University care center, active interdisciplinary programs and comprehensive care for orthognathic surgery patients, cleft palate patients, and craniofacial growth problems are provided.
In our specialty practice at the UofL School of Dentistry, treatment is performed by licensed dentists who desire to specialize in orthodontics and have been selected for their two-year residency position from a very large number of highly qualified applicants.
